Human Resources Manager

Turbine Engine Services (TES) is a growing aerospace ma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) organization supporting commercial and defense aviation customers. TES is committed to operational excellence, regulatory compliance, and developing a high-performing workforce that supports the critical needs of the aerospace industry.

We are seeking an experienced Human Resources Manager to lead the HR function and partner with leadership to support the company’s continued growth.

Position Overview

The Human Resources Manager will oversee the day-to-day operations of the Human Resources department while working closely with leadership to implement strategic workforce initiatives. This role will manage recruitment, employee relations, compliance, compensation, and organizational development programs that support TES’s operational goals.

This position plays a key role in maintaining a strong workplace culture while ensuring compliance with employment regulations and aerospace industry standards.

Compliance & HR Operations
  • Maintain comp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ws and regulations.
  • Ensure compliance with FAA regulatory requirements , including the Drug & Alcohol Abatement Program .
  • Conduct internal HR audits and maintain accurate personnel documentation.
  • Stay current on regulatory changes impacting employment and the aerospace industry.
